As of July 01, 2026, the average annual salary for ICU Director in California is $196,766, equivalent to $95 per hour, $3,784 weekly, or $16,397 monthly. These figures, sourced from Salary.com’s real-time job posting scans, highlight competitive earning potential for ICU Director in cities like San Jose, Santa Clara, and San Francisco.

Annually Salaries for ICU Director in California vary widely, spanning from $158,147 to $225,073. Most professionals fall between the 25th percentile ($176,551) and 75th percentile ($211,583), while top earners (90th percentile) make $225,073 per year. What is An ICU Director ?

The salary for an ICU Director typically ranges from $150,000 to $250,000 annually, depending on factors such as geographic location, years of experience, and the size of the healthcare facility. This role involves overseeing the operations of the Intensive Care Unit, ensuring high standards of patient care, managing staff, and coordinating with other departments. Responsibilities also include developing policies, implementing best practices, and maintaining compliance with healthcare regulations.
